Bioactivity
Lanthionine is a naturally occurring non-protein amino acid formed by the cross-linking of two alanine residues via a thioether bond at the β-carbon atom. It constitutes the key component of the cyclic peptide antibiotic lantibiotic. Lanthionine exhibits inhibitory activity against diaminopimelate (DAP) epimerase, with a Ki value of 420 μM.
